Key Takeaways
- Machine learning development follows 7 essential stages: problem definition, data collection, data preparation, model selection, model training, model evaluation, and deployment.
- Each stage plays a critical role in building accurate, scalable, and business-ready AI solutions.
- Startups focus on rapid iteration and lightweight models, while enterprises prioritize governance, accuracy, and large-scale AI integration.
- Techniques like AutoML, MLOps, fine-tuning, and deep learning accelerate modern AI development.
- Successful AI implementation requires continuous monitoring, retraining, and performance optimization.
- Companies partnering with a reliable AI development company gain faster deployment, better accuracy, and long-term scalability.
What Are the 7 Stages of Machine Learning? (Explained Simply for 2025)
Machine learning development generally follows seven essential stages: problem definition, data collection, data preparation, model selection, model training, model evaluation, and deployment & monitoring.
These steps form the foundation of modern artificial intelligence development, helping businesses build scalable, accurate, and production-ready AI systems.
This guide explains each stage clearly, whether you're a startup building your first AI app, an enterprise modernizing operations, or someone exploring how machine learning models are actually developed.
1. What Are the 7 Stages of Machine Learning?
While different AI frameworks describe machine learning workflows differently, the widely accepted seven stages are:
- Define the problem
- Collect data
- Prepare & clean the data
- Select the right ML model
- Train the model
- Evaluate the model
- Deploy, monitor, and improve the model
Every AI solution—from predictive analytics to generative AI—goes through these steps. Understanding these stages helps businesses make better decisions about AI integration, AI models, data strategy, and development processes.
Want to Build ML Models Faster and More Accurately?
Work with a Top AI Development Company that builds production-ready AI systems for startups and enterprises.
2. Why Machine Learning Stages Matter in 2025
Machine learning isn't just a technical process anymore, it’s a business capability. Companies across healthcare, manufacturing, retail, real estate, logistics, and finance now depend on ML-driven automation, predictive analytics, computer vision, NLP, and deep learning applications.
By following a structured 7-stage development process, organizations get:
- Reliable, explainable AI models
- Faster AI deployment
- Better model accuracy and performance
- Scalable AI systems that work with existing software
- A clearer roadmap for AI investment
In 2025, where AI development services are becoming mainstream, understanding these stages is essential for strategic planning.
3. Stage 1 - Problem Definition: Knowing What to Solve
Machine learning begins with a simple question: “What decision or task should the model improve?”
Poor problem framing leads to wasted effort — even with perfect data and advanced algorithms.
Key questions AI teams ask:
- What business problem are we solving?
- What KPIs define success?
- Is ML necessary, or will rules-based automation work?
- What type of machine learning fits best (supervised, unsupervised, reinforcement, or semi-supervised)?
Business examples
- Retail: Predicting customer churn
- Real Estate: Forecasting property values
- Manufacturing: Detecting faulty products using computer vision
- Finance: Fraud detection using pattern analysis
Clear scoping ensures alignment between business goals and technical execution.
4. Stage 2 - Data Collection: Building the Foundation
Every AI model depends on high-quality data. The data collection stage defines how reliable and accurate your ML model will be.
Where data comes from:
- Internal databases
- CRM and ERP systems
- IoT sensors
- Web scraping
- Public datasets
- Third-party APIs
- Real-time event streams
For startups with limited data, synthetic data or pre-trained AI models can accelerate development.
Types of data collected:
- Text (NLP)
- Images (computer vision)
- Audio
- Structured tables
- Sensor data
- User behavior logs
In modern AI software development, data strategy is now as important as algorithm selection.
5. Stage 3 - Data Preparation: Cleaning, Labeling & Organizing
Also called data preprocessing, this stage can take up to 60–80% of the entire ML lifecycle.
Data prep includes:
- Removing duplicates
- Handling missing values
- Normalizing values
- Encoding categorical features
- Splitting data into training, testing, and validation sets
- Labeling data for supervised learning
Why this stage matters
Without clean data, even the most sophisticated neural networks will produce inaccurate or biased results. Businesses often use specialized AI development services for large-scale annotation tasks, especially in computer vision and NLP.
6. Stage 4 - Model Selection: Choosing the Right Algorithm
Choosing the right machine learning model is one of the most strategic decisions in the entire AI development lifecycle. Even with high-quality data, the wrong model can lead to poor accuracy, slow prediction time, or high infrastructure cost. That’s why AI teams carefully evaluate the problem type, data structure, and business objectives before selecting a model.
Common models used:
- Linear Regression (predictions)
- Random Forest (classification)
- Support Vector Machines
- Decision Trees
- Neural Networks
- CNNs (for images)
- RNNs and Transformers (for text and sequences)
Startups often prioritize simpler models for faster iteration. Enterprises may adopt advanced deep learning models for highly accurate AI solutions.
Factors influencing model choice:
- Accuracy requirements
- Training time
- Explainability
- Deployment environment
- Real-time processing needs
No single model works for everything; smart selection drives results.
7. Stage 5 - Model Training: Teaching the Model to Learn
Model training is the heart of the machine learning lifecycle. This is where the algorithm transforms from a simple mathematical function into an intelligent system capable of recognizing patterns, making predictions, and supporting real-time decision-making. Whether you're building a recommendation engine, fraud detection model, or a generative AI system, training is the stage that determines how accurately your AI will perform in real-world environments.
What happens during training?
- The model analyzes input data
- It adjusts weights & parameters
- It learns to minimize error (loss function)
- It iterates thousands or millions of times
Training requires computing resources such as GPUs, TPUs, or cloud-based AI infrastructure.
Key Techniques Used During Model Training
1. Gradient Descent — How Models Learn Step-by-Step
Gradient descent is an optimization method that helps the model reduce errors. It calculates how each parameter should change to move closer to the minimum loss. Think of it like walking downhill toward the lowest point in a valley — step by step.
2. Backpropagation - The Engine Behind Neural Networks
Backpropagation computes how wrong each neuron was and adjusts its weights accordingly. It works by:
- Moving forward through the network → generating predictions
- Moving backward → updating weights based on errors
3. Fine-Tuning Pre-Trained Models
Instead of training from scratch, developers now use pre-trained models and adapt them to business-specific datasets.
- Fine-tuning BERT for customer sentiment analysis
- Customizing a CNN for product defect detection
- Adapting a Transformer for industry-specific text generation
4. Hyperparameter Optimization - Tuning for the Best Performance
Hyperparameters control how the model learns (learning rate, batch size, number of layers, dropout rate, etc.). Finding the optimal configuration can massively boost performance.
- Grid search
- Random search
- Bayesian optimization
- Automated tuning tools (AutoML)
Modern AI development companies in USA use automated ML pipelines (AutoML, MLOps) to speed up this process.
8. Stage 6 - Model Evaluation: Measuring Performance
After training, the model is tested against unseen data.
Key evaluation metrics:
- Accuracy
- Precision & Recall
- F1 Score
- ROC-AUC
- Mean Absolute Error
- Confusion Matrix
Why evaluation matters
A model that performs well during training but poorly in production may suffer from issues like overfitting, bias, or insufficient testing. Businesses must ensure the model is robust across edge cases, seasons, customer groups, and real-world variations.
9. Stage 7 - Deployment, Monitoring & Scaling
Once the model passes evaluation, it's deployed into real applications.
Deployment options:
- Cloud (AWS, Azure, GCP)
- On-premise
- Edge devices
- Mobile apps
- Existing enterprise systems
What happens after deployment?
- The model is continuously monitored
- Data drifts are detected
- Performance is retrained or improved
- Feedback loops refine accuracy
MLOps tools automate deployment pipelines, helping companies scale AI systems more efficiently.
Need Production-Ready AI & Machine Learning Systems?
Partner with AI experts who build, deploy, and maintain scalable ML models tailored to your business.
10. How Startups vs Enterprises Approach the 7 Stages
Startups Focus On:
- ✓ Rapid prototyping
- ✓ Lean data collection
- ✓ Pre-trained AI models
- ✓ Cost-effective deployment
- ✓ Cloud-native development
They need speed, flexibility, and minimal overhead.
Enterprises Focus On:
- ✓ Data governance
- ✓ Privacy and compliance
- ✓ Model explainability
- ✓ Integration with legacy systems
- ✓ Large-scale automation
They require reliability, audit trails, and long-term scalability.
Both benefit from structured AI development processes, but priorities differ dramatically.
11. Common Challenges in the Machine Learning Lifecycle
- 1. Insufficient or low-quality data: Models can’t learn without representative data.
- 2. Data silos inside organizations: Enterprises often struggle to unify fragmented data sources.
- 3. High computational cost: Deep learning requires expensive infrastructure.
- 4. Model bias and fairness issues: Models can inherit human or systemic bias.
- 5. Deployment delays: Many organizations build great models — but never move them to production.
- 6. Model decay: AI systems lose accuracy over time without monitoring.
These challenges illustrate why partnering with experienced AI developers is critical for sustainable AI success.
12. How AI Development Services Help Across All 7 Stages
A professional AI development company streamlines the ML lifecycle by offering:
Strategic Support
- Problem framing
- AI roadmap creation
- Data strategy development
Technical Expertise
- AI model development
- Data engineering & annotation
- Model training & optimization
- Building custom AI solutions
MLOps & Deployment
- Production-ready pipelines
- Continuous monitoring
- Real-time analytics
Startups accelerate product development. Enterprises modernize operations. Both achieve long-term AI ROI.
13. Conclusion
The seven stages of machine learning form the foundation of every successful AI project. From defining the problem to deploying and monitoring the model, each step ensures your AI solution delivers measurable business outcomes.
In 2025, as AI development services continue to evolve, companies that follow a structured ML lifecycle will build more accurate, scalable, and intelligent systems that outperform their competitors.
Accelerate Your AI Journey with Industry Experts
Whether you're a startup or enterprise, we build custom AI solutions that deliver measurable results.
👉 Start Your AI Project TodayMeet the Author

Co-Founder, Rytsense Technologies
Karthik is the Co-Founder of Rytsense Technologies, where he leads cutting-edge projects at the intersection of Data Science and Generative AI. With nearly a decade of hands-on experience in data-driven innovation, he has helped businesses unlock value from complex data through advanced analytics, machine learning, and AI-powered solutions. Currently, his focus is on building next-generation Generative AI applications that are reshaping the way enterprises operate and scale. When not architecting AI systems, Karthik explores the evolving future of technology, where creativity meets intelligence.